Emerson Colonial Theatre, Boston
Emerson Colonial Theatre, which opened in 1900 with a production of Ben-Hur, is the oldest continuously operated theater in Boston as well as being among the most magnificent, having retained much of its original period details.
Emerson Colonial Theatre is an Ambassador Theatre Group venue. John Tiedemann Inc./HPCS USA has a great deal of experience restoring old theatres. In this case, we were commissioned to restore the Colonial Theater’s interior, which included extensive conservation cleaning, conducting plaster repairs, decorative painting, gilding, and restoring the decorative paint scheme. The theater now feels fresh again, like the day it opened.
